1What is a realistic budget range for a full kitchen remodel in Akron, MI?

For a full remodel in the Akron area, including new cabinets, countertops, flooring, appliances, and labor, homeowners can expect a range of $25,000 to $50,000+, depending on material choices and scope. Michigan's seasonal construction cycle can influence pricing, with some contractors offering more competitive rates during the slower winter months. It's crucial to get multiple detailed, written estimates from local, licensed contractors to understand the current market rates in Tuscola County.

2How does Michigan's climate and seasons affect the remodeling timeline?

Akron's cold winters and humid summers can impact material delivery and certain installation steps. For instance, flooring materials like hardwood need time to acclimate to your home's humidity levels before installation, which is vital given our seasonal swings. Scheduling interior demolition and dusty work for winter can be ideal, but planning around major holidays and a contractor's busy spring/summer schedule is key to an accurate timeline.

3Are there any local permits or regulations in Akron I need to be aware of for my kitchen remodel?

Yes, most structural, electrical, and plumbing work in Akron will require permits from the Village of Akron or Tuscola County Building Department. This ensures work meets Michigan Residential Code standards, which is critical for safety and future home resale. A reputable local contractor will typically handle this process, but as the homeowner, you are ultimately responsible for ensuring permits are pulled and inspections are passed.

5My kitchen is in an older Akron home. What are common unexpected issues I should budget for?

In Akron's older homes, it's common to discover outdated wiring (like knob-and-tube), plumbing that needs updating to current code, or uneven floors and walls that require leveling. Additionally, older cabinets may reveal structural issues or lead paint that requires special handling during removal. A thorough inspection by your contractor during the estimate phase can help identify these, but always allocate a contingency fund of 10-20% of your budget for such surprises.
